Ellen Dunha...</p> https://archinect.com/news/article/150167870/francisco-javier-rodr-guez-su-rez-announced-as-university-of-illinois-at-urbana-champaign-s-school-of-architecture-director Francisco Javier Rodríguez-Suárez announced as University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ign's School of Architecture Director Katherine Guimapang 2019-11-01T21:04:00-04:00 >2019-11-04T19:51:03-05:00 <img src="https://archinect.gumlet.io/uploads/92/922f39f357b8ba6d211e49201cfcb136.jpg?fit=crop&auto=compress%2Cformat&enlarge=true&w=1200" border="0" /><p>The <a href="https://archinect.com/schools/cover/1863632/university-of-illinois-at-urbana-champaign" target="_blank">University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ign's School of Architecture</a> today announced Francisco Javier Rodr&iacute;guez-Su&aacute;rez, FAIA as its next Director. Said to be joining the university in January 2020, Rodr&iacute;guez-Su&aacute;rez currently serves as the ACSA Distinguished Professor of Architecture at the <a href="https://archinect.com/uprarchitecture" target="_blank">University of Puerto Rico</a>. He also served as the Dean from 2007 to 2016.&nbsp;</p> <p>With his experience as a practicing architect, academic, writer, and leader in the architecture profession, he has played a pivotal role in leading the School of Architecture at the University of Puerto Rico and its prominence amongst the Caribbean and Ilbero-Americas.&nbsp;</p> <p>Rodr&iacute;guez-Su&aacute;rez studied at <a href="https://archinect.com/GTArchitecture" target="_blank">Georgia Tech</a>, the Universit&eacute; de Paris, and <a href="https://archinect.com/harvard" target="_blank">Harvard University&rsquo;s Graduate School of Design</a>. At the GSD is where he earned a Master of Architecture with Distinction and American Institute of Architects (AIA) School Medal. To highlight this progress, the <a href="https://archinect.com/schools/cover/1863632/university-of-illinois-at-urbana-champaign" target="_blank">School of Architecture at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ign</a> is paying homage to previous female graduates who earned a degree in architecture from the school, starting with&nbsp;Mary Louisa Page in 1878. Page was he first woman to graduate from architecture school in North America; The university began offering architecture courses a decade earlier in 1868.</p> <p>Now, in 2019, the university aims to recognize the contributions its female graduates have made to the architectural profession by hosting a <em><a href="https://arch.illinois.edu/arch-womens-symposium" target="_blank">Women's Reunion and Symposium</a></em> from September 26th to the 28th. In addition to the symposium, the school will host an exhibition titled <a href="https://bustler.net/events/12351/revealing-presence-women-in-architecture-at-the-university-of-illinois-1874-2019" target="_blank"><em>Revealing Presence: Women in Architecture at the University of Illinois 1874-2019</em></a>&nbsp;that highlights the work created by some of these graduates.&nbsp;</p> <figure><p><a href="https://archinect.gumlet.io/uploads/d2/d2ce67edf6544f3afacb68726265e727.jpg?auto=compress%2Cformat&amp;w=1028" target="_blank"><img src="https://archinect.gumlet.io/uploads/d2/d2ce67edf6544f3afacb68726265e727.jpg?auto=compress%2Cformat&amp;w=514"></a></p><figcaption>School of Architecture alumni dig...</figcaption></figure> https://archinect.com/news/article/150037437/get-lectured-university-of-illinois-at-urbana-champaign-fall-17 Get Lectured: University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, Fall '17 Justine Testado 2017-11-13T20:24:00-05:00 >2017-11-13T20:24:51-05:00 <img src="https://archinect.gumlet.io/uploads/lx/lxmletaaofo7zwl2.jpg?fit=crop&auto=compress%2Cformat&enlarge=true&w=1200" border="0" /><p><strong><a href="http://archinect.com/news/tag/871644/2017-lectures" rel="nofollow" target="_blank">Archinect's Architecture School Lecture Guide for Fall 2017</a></strong><br></p> <p>Ready or not, it's the start of a new school year.
